The science behind drying herbs is rooted in osmosis and evaporation. When an herb is harvested, its cells contain up to 80% water. To preserve it, this water must be removed without damaging the cell walls, which house the essential oils responsible for flavor and fragrance. The goal is to reduce moisture to 10–15% of the herb’s total weight—a threshold that inhibits microbial growth while maintaining structural integrity. Temperature plays a critical role: below 118°F (48°C), enzymes remain stable, preserving color and aroma; above this, oxidation accelerates, turning vibrant green herbs into dull, flavorless husks. Airflow is the unsung hero of **how to dehydrate herbs without a dehydrator**. Static air traps moisture, creating a humid microclimate that encourages mold. Instead, herbs need a gentle breeze—whether from a fan, natural ventilation, or even the convection currents in an oven—to carry away vapor. This is why hanging herbs in small bunches or spreading them in a single layer on a screen works: it maximizes surface area exposure to moving air. The herb’s morphology also dictates the method—delicate leaves like dill benefit from slow, even drying, while thick-stemmed herbs like rosemary can tolerate higher temperatures without losing potency.Key Benefits and Crucial Impact

Comparative Analysis
| Method | Best For |
|---|---|
| Sun-Drying (Outdoor/Indoor) | Hardy herbs (rosemary, thyme, sage) in dry climates. Avoid for high-moisture herbs like mint. |
| Oven-Drying (Low Heat, Door Ajar) | All herbs in humid climates or small batches. Risk of uneven drying if temperature fluctuates. |
| Stovetop/Steam Method (Over Simmering Pot) | Delicate herbs (parsley, cilantro) where gentle heat is critical. |
| Air-Drying (Hanging Bundles) | Woody stems (lavender, oregano) where structural integrity matters. |

Q: Can I dehydrate herbs in the oven without a dehydrator?
A: Yes, but with precautions. Preheat the oven to its lowest setting (around 95–115°F/35–46°C), place herbs on a baking sheet lined with parchment paper in a single layer, and prop the oven door open slightly with a wooden spoon to allow moisture to escape. Check every 30–60 minutes to prevent overheating, which can turn herbs to dust. This method works best for small batches and herbs with low moisture content, like thyme or oregano.
Q: How do I know when herbs are fully dehydrated?
A: Herbs are ready when they are dry to the touch, brittle, and crumble easily between your fingers. For leafy herbs, stems should snap cleanly. Store-bought dried herbs often feel slightly leathery, but for maximum potency, aim for a crisp texture. Test by storing a small amount in an airtight container for a week—if no mold appears and the aroma remains strong, they’re fully dehydrated.

Q: Can I dry herbs with flowers, like lavender?
A: Absolutely, but treat them differently than leafy herbs. For flower-heavy herbs like lavender, air-drying in small bundles is ideal: tie stems into groups of 3–5 and hang them upside down in a dark, dry place (like a closet) for 1–2 weeks. This preserves the flowers’ structure and color. Avoid high heat, as it can cause the petals to darken or crumble. Once fully dried, gently brush off excess debris before storing.
Q: How do I store dehydrated herbs to maintain freshness?
A: Store herbs in airtight containers—glass jars with tight-sealing lids or vacuum-sealed bags—to block light, air, and moisture, which degrade flavor and potency. Keep containers in a cool, dark place (like a pantry) away from the stove or fridge door, where temperature fluctuations occur. Label each jar with the herb name and date, as even properly dried herbs lose potency over time. Most retain their best flavor for 6–12 months, though some hardy herbs like rosemary can last up to 2 years.
Q: What’s the quickest method for drying herbs without a dehydrator?
A: For speed, the oven method (as described above) or a hairdryer on low heat (with herbs spread on a screen and held 6–12 inches away) are the fastest, taking 1–4 hours depending on the herb. However, these methods require constant monitoring to avoid overheating. Sun-drying is the slowest but most hands-off, taking 1–3 weeks in ideal conditions.
